Anant National University, Ahmedabad, prescribes the B.Des 2026 fees structure on its official website - anu.edu.in. The Anant National University fee 2026 for B.Des is around Rs 550000 per annum. The Anant National University B.Des fee 2026 includes components such as tuition fee, caution money, and residence and hostel fee. Candidates appearing for ADEPT 2026 will be required to pay the ANU B.Des fee at the time of admission. The university conducts the Anant Design Entrance and Proficiency Test in online mode for admissions into its 4-year B.Des programme.
Candidates can check the breakdown of Anant National University fees structure for BDes which include tuition fees, residence, and mess fees.
Particulars | Fees (in Rs) |
Application Fee (one time) | 1,500 |
Tuition Fee | 5,50,000 per annum |
Double Occupancy | Fees Year 1 |
(On Campus) | 3,02,500 |
(Off-Campus) | 2,75,000 |
The application fee for the BDes programme is Rs. 1,500.
Tuition, residence, and mess fees will increase by 10% every year.
At the beginning, a refundable caution deposit of Rs. 10,000 is required. The caution deposit will be returned to the students when they complete their final year of study or withdraw.
The refund of the Anant National University BDes fee will be done as per the UGC guidelines. The details are given below.
Date of Withdrawal | Refund Percentage |
15 days or more before the formally notified last date of admission | 100% |
Less than 15 days before the formally notified last date of admission | 90% |
15 days or less after the formally notified last date of admission | 80% |
30 days or less but more than 15 days after the formally notified last date of admission | 50% |
More than 30 days after formally notified last date of admission | 0% |
Many students face financial challenges while pursuing higher education. To help students with education loans on specific terms, Anant National University has partnered with Axis, HDFC, and IDFC. This will enable students to cover their tuition fees, and other educational expenses, helping them to focus on their studies without financial stress.
Anant National University provides merit-based scholarships to students based on their academic performance. To ease the burden of the students the university offers scholarships. Check the below table to get a clear overview of merit-based financial aid.
UCEED Rank | Financial Aid % for Tuition Fee | Financial Aid % for Hostel Fee |
1 – 250 | 100% | 100% |
| 251 - 500 | 100% | 50% |
501-1000 | 100% | - |
1001-2000 | 75% | - |
2001-2500 | 25% | - |
Anant National University offers education to talented and deserving students who experience financial limitations in pursuing their higher education. The university offers need-based scholarships, starting from partial to a complete waiver of tuition fees. The candidate’s financial capability is evaluated based on the following factors:
Family income
Savings
Investments
education loans
